Sambalpur: A 14-year-old girl went missing after allegedly jumping into the Mahanadi River from the Chaunrpur Bridge in Odisha's Sambalpur on Saturday night.

Fire Services personnel launched a search operation, but strong river currents and darkness hampered rescue efforts, with no trace of the girl found till the latest reports.

The girl, a resident of Mayabagicha area, had reportedly called a neighbouring girl shortly before the incident and informed her that she was about to jump into the river. The call alerted others, following which police and rescue teams rushed to the spot.

According to locals, the girl had been speaking with her male friend. The two had an argument, after which she told her family that she was going to a neighbour's house and left home. She is believed to have later met the boy at the bridge, where another argument broke out.

Police said that around 10 pm, the girl made the call to her neighbour before jumping into the river in the presence of the boy.

The girl's male friend has been detained for questioning, while police have also questioned the young woman who received the call from the minor.
